unofficial mirror of bug-gnu-emacs@gnu.org 
 help / color / mirror / code / Atom feed
* bug#6280: 24.0.50; (elisp) Dedicated Windows
@ 2010-05-27 15:51 Drew Adams
  2010-05-27 17:24 ` martin rudalics
  0 siblings, 1 reply; 13+ messages in thread
From: Drew Adams @ 2010-05-27 15:51 UTC (permalink / raw)
  To: 6280

A user just asked on help-gnu-emacs for a "way to specify that windows
containing buffers which have a certain mode should *never* be reused or
closed unless specifically by user action (for example visiting a new
file from the window)". This info is not readily available, but it
should be.
 
The doc about dedicated windows is missing a few things.
 
1. There should be something in the Emacs manual about how to make
windows be dedicated - esp. by default. There is nothing in the manual
about it AFAICT. The closest thing is node `Special Buffer Frames'.
 
[The node name is a misnomer, BTW: it should be `Special-Buffer Frames'
or `Frames for Special Buffers'.  It is the buffers that are special
buffers, not "buffer frames" that are special.]
 
2. In the Elisp manual, the node `Dedicated Windows' would presumably
cover this topic, but there is no real mention there of special-display
stuff, which is the way a user will typically try to make windows in
general dedicated.  There is a link to the node `Choosing Window', but
it is not obvious that that is the link to follow to get the relevant
info.  It simply says "`display-buffer' (*note Choosing Window::) never
uses a dedicated window for displaying another buffer in it."
 
Please present the topic of dedicated windows in a way that is more
useful to users such as the OP in help-gnu-emacs.  Provide, for
instance:
 
* a simple recipe for making all windows dedicated and
 
* a simple recipe for making all windows for buffers in a certain mode
dedicated

In GNU Emacs 24.0.50.1 (i386-mingw-nt5.1.2600)
 of 2010-05-23 on G41R2F1
Windowing system distributor `Microsoft Corp.', version 5.1.2600
configured using `configure --with-gcc (3.4) --no-opt --cflags -Ic:/xpm/include'
 






^ permalink raw reply	[flat|nested] 13+ messages in thread

end of thread, other threads:[~2014-02-10 17:02 UTC | newest]

Thread overview: 13+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2010-05-27 15:51 bug#6280: 24.0.50; (elisp) Dedicated Windows Drew Adams
2010-05-27 17:24 ` martin rudalics
2010-05-27 17:51   ` Drew Adams
2010-05-28  9:19     ` martin rudalics
2010-05-28 14:13       ` Drew Adams
2010-05-28 15:10         ` martin rudalics
2010-05-28 16:16           ` Drew Adams
2010-05-29  8:20             ` martin rudalics
2014-02-10  3:19           ` Lars Ingebrigtsen
2014-02-10  3:32             ` Drew Adams
2014-02-10  8:15               ` martin rudalics
2014-02-10 16:52                 ` Stefan Monnier
2014-02-10 17:02                   ` Drew Adams

Code repositories for project(s) associated with this public inbox

	https://git.savannah.gnu.org/cgit/emacs.git

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).